EMV in the USA
Posted:
August 09, 2011
Author:
Mercator Research
Abstract:
EMV is, at last, coming to the USA. The sitting duck in the global payments pond will become the more swan-like global security framework that will make counterfeit cards much harder to create. Visa's active encouragement of EMV contact and contactless terminal deployment lays the groundwork for the smartphone-based transaction world everyone's been hoping for. The magstripe is, at last, losing its role as the central payment origination method and headed, no doubt, for a long retirement in niche applications. It's time.
